The Langstone Gold Cup Averages Trophy
Outside of the Grand National race perhaps the most prestigious award competed for annually by NFC members is The Langstone Gold Cup. This trophy is a awarded to the Member who achieves the highest average velocity when combining his/her first timer from the ‘short’ OB race, the Grand National, and the YB race. Structured thus the winning Member must score well from a range of distances with pigeons of all ages making it an extremely competitive and unpredictable competition.
The trophy itself is named after J W Langstone himself a winner of the 1954 Nantes and 1956 Pau races.

Averages for a specific year are great, insofar as they go. However in accounting terms they are an annual Profit and Loss account for the financial year rather than a Balance Sheet reflecting the ongoing state of the business. By this I mean we are analysing one year in isolation from all others, rather than analysing extended trends.
Can we calculate the leading averages based on the last two years’ sets of results? Perhaps even three or four years? This will unmask the fanciers scoring consistently from race to race over a longer period with old and young birds. Well as you might expect by now I’ve done just that!

No instances where the same pigeon being the first arrival from both Nantes and Pau were found. Remember that in 2003 the pigeons were brought back from Pau to Saintes so we are not entirely comparing apples with apples on a year-to-year basis.
